AVERILL PARK

— Carole Quinn passed away on June 7, 2022, at the age of 79.

She was the oldest of nine children born to Clifford and Zillah Herrington of Johnsonvil­le. After graduating from Hoosic Valley Central School, she attended Cortland College. Carole married her husband, Steve Wicks, on December 31, 1994.

Carole had a sharp wit and engaging laugh. Being raised on a dairy farm, she knew the value of hard work and had a love of the land and animals, particular­ly horses. The only thing that surpassed that love was the love for her family. She had two sons, Mark and Matt Quinn and two stepchildr­en, Michael Wicks and Tina Schoonmake­r. Both sons raced cars regularly at Lebanon Valley Speedway. She would not miss a race and eventually drove the pace car for years leading them out for their starting laps. She was, with no doubt, their biggest fan.

Carole held many jobs over the years including working at restaurant­s, cooking at 4H camp, the post office as well as driving a school bus just as her father had. She worked side by side with Steve at Steve’s Automotive in West Sand Lake until it was sold. She made many lifelong friends in all of these positions throughout her life.

Her farm, Sunrise Hill Farm in Averill Park, was her last home before she and Steve started traveling to Florida for the winter months in their RV with their dog Willy. It was at that farm that she taught her children and grandchild­ren all about her love for animals, riding lessons, gardening and what chores actually are.
